How to Prepare Your Home for Strong Winds and Hurricanes in Texas

Living in Texas means being prepared for the possibility of strong winds and hurricanes, especially in areas like Corpus Christi, San Antonio and along the Gulf Coast. Understanding the Risks

Texas is no stranger to hurricanes and high winds, which can cause significant damage to homes and property. From flying debris to flooding and roof damage, the risks are real; however, with the right preparation, you can minimize potential losses.

Storms can strike with little warning, but a well-prepared home can make all the difference. The following tips can help protect your property before, during, and after a storm.

Before the Storm—Preparation Tips

  • Inspect your roof and gutters. Secure loose shingles, clean out gutters, and ensure downspouts direct water away from your foundation.
  • Reinforce windows and doors. Install storm shutters or cover windows with plywood. Check that doors are sturdy and have proper seals.
  • Secure outdoor items. Bring patio furniture, grills and decorations indoors. Anchor sheds, playsets and other large items.
  • Trim trees and shrubs. Remove dead branches and keep trees well-trimmed to reduce the risk of falling limbs.
  • Prepare an emergency kit. Include water, nonperishable food, flashlights, batteries, medications and important documents.
  • Review your insurance coverage. Make sure your windstorm and flood insurance are up to date and provide adequate coverage levels based on your home value and belongings.

During the Storm—Safety First

  • Stay indoors. Keep away from windows and glass doors.
  • Monitor weather updates. Use a battery-powered radio or mobile alerts for real-time information.
  • Follow evacuation orders. If local authorities advise evacuation, do so promptly and safely.

After the Storm—Assess and Recover

  • Inspect your property. Check for damage once it’s safe. Take photos for insurance purposes.
  • Prevent further damage. Cover broken windows or damaged roofs with tarps until repairs can be made.
  • Contact your insurance agent. Report any damage as soon as possible to start the claims process.
